Program areas at Repower Fund
Movement technology:re:power Fund's movement technology work develops community-led technology skills of data and digital practitioners who are advancing change in our communities.
Governance re:poweRepowerer Fund's governance program supports newly elected officials through our progressive governance academy (pga) to build power with peers and local movement actors, while also strengthening their skills in governance for a lifelong career in public leadership. The pga is partnership between re:poweRepowerer Fund, state innovation exchange (six), and local progress.
Movement building: re:poweRepowerer Fund's movement building program supports powerful organizations & coalitions to organize and mobilize campaigns through strategic planning, coaching, and capacity building.
Women of color leadership: re:poweRepowerer Fund's women of color leadership program is creating a robust pipeline of our future women of color leaders by engaging in skills development, relationship building, and fostering resilience.
Civic engagement:re:power Fund's civic engagement work trains aspiring leaders and elected officials to harness their power and develop their leadership to build a reflective democracy.

Financials for Repower Fund
Revenues | FYE 12/2022 | FYE 12/2021 | % Change |
---|
Total grants, contributions, etc. | $5,582,234 | $3,214,084 | 73.7% |
Program services | $807,942 | $1,106,652 | -27% |
Investment income and dividends | $3,731 | $621 | 500.8% |
Tax-exempt bond proceeds | $0 | $0 | - |
Royalty revenue | $0 | $0 | - |
Net rental income | $0 | $1,260 | -100% |
Net gain from sale of non-inventory assets | $0 | $0 | - |
Net income from fundraising events | $0 | $0 | - |
Net income from gaming activities | $0 | $0 | - |
Net income from sales of inventory | $0 | $0 | - |
Miscellaneous revenues | $105 | $0 | 999% |
Total revenues | $6,394,012 | $4,322,617 | 47.9% |
